Data: Bitcoin Mining Costs $33,900, Current Market Price Premium Nearly 3X
According to Glassnode, an on-chain data analytics platform, the difficulty regression model estimates that it costs $33,900 to mine one bitcoin, while the current bitcoin trading price is around $104,000.
While the difficulty of mining has continued to rise in this cycle, the approximately 3x profit margin demonstrates the resilience of miners.
